    I am trying this plugin before I consider buying it and getting a pretty annoying error.
    This plugin overrides my theme’s product gallery and has no zoom, which I am not a fan of. Does this change in the PRO version?
    When I disable SVI on products without variations (to gain back my default gallery) I get an error and no images instead.

    Error shows this instead of the image:
    Warning: include(): Filename cannot be empty in /home1/charlie/punpunia.com/st/wp-content/plugins/woocommerce/includes/wc-core-functions.php on line 211

    Warning: include(): Filename cannot be empty in /home1/charlie/punpunia.com/st/wp-content/plugins/woocommerce/includes/wc-core-functions.php on line 211

    Warning: include(): Failed opening ” for inclusion (include_path=’.:/opt/php70/lib/php’) in /home1/charlie/punpunia.com/st/wp-content/plugins/woocommerce/includes/wc-core-functions.php on line 211

    Disabling the plugin and going back to the default gallery works perfectly, of course.

    I am looking into all plugins that make variations easier and this one is my favorite but I cannot make the purchase when it’s working like this. Having no kind of zoom on product gallery is kind of annoying too.

    – Yes, SVI replaces your default theme settings/options for the image & thumbnails area so don’t expect to use any of your theme features for this area. Otherwise I wouldn’t be able to do the magic. This because each theme has is own structure I cant create 1000+ variations of the same plugin so I just have to put mine.

    – Bug: Default gallery, true there is an error showing up, and I will fix it immediately thanks for reporting it. My next release will have it fixed.

    SVI you have the “lens option” in the free version you only have access to the lens but in the pro you have access to more. checkout the demo page.
